Spicy Salmon Hand Cut Roll is a popular sushi dish rooted in Japanese cuisine, known for its bold flavors and fresh ingredients. This roll features tender, diced salmon mixed with spicy mayo or chili sauce, delivering a zesty kick. Wrapped in seasoned seaweed and vinegared sushi rice, it may include avocado, scallions, or cucumber for added texture and nutrients. Rich in omega-3 fatty acids, the salmon promotes heart health and supports cognitive function, while the nori provides dietary fiber and essential vitamins like B12 and iodine. The sushi rice contributes carbohydrates for energy, but its sugar and vinegar content should be consumed in moderation. Spicy Salmon Rolls can be a protein-packed, nutritious choice when eaten in balance, though the spicy mayo adds calories and fat. Typically served as bite-sized pieces, they combine wellness and indulgence, offering a flavorful representation of traditional Japanese sushi culture.
